找回密码
 立即注册

QQ登录

只需一步,快速开始

扫一扫,访问微社区

查看: 910|回复: 0

[LISP程序]:俺的画内六角圆柱头螺钉的LISP程序

[复制链接]
发表于 2002-5-30 04:23:34 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?立即注册

×
1)B_SCREW_COLUMN.DCL
/*;这是一个基于AutoCad 14.0下画螺钉的程序
;本程序作者b.w
;本程序无偿使用
;如有更好建议,请联系b.w
;版本:2.0.01
;日期:14/02-2002
*/

B_SCREW_COLUMN: dialog
   {
   aspect_ralio=0;
   label = "***紧固件——内六角圆柱头螺钉***  版本:试用版";
   :boxed_column
     {
     label = " ";
     :row
       {
       :column
         {
         :boxed_column
           {
           label = "当前视图&V";
           :column
             {
             children_alignment=centered;
             :image_button
               {
               key = "B_SCREW_COLUMN_VIEW_DCL";
               color                   = 0;
               width                   = 25;
               aspect_ratio            = 0.5;
               fixed_height            = true;
               fixed_width             = true;
               alignment = centered;
               }
             :popup_list
               {
               label = "视图选择&I: ";
               key = "B_SCREW_COLUMN_VIEW_S_DCL";
               list = "主  视  图\n侧  视  图";
               edit_width =10;
               }  
             }
           }
         :boxed_column
           {
           label = "插入点&P";
           :button
             {
             label = "选 择 点&E <";
             key = "B_SCREW_COLUMN_CENTER_DCL";
             alignment = centered;
             }
           :edit_box
             {
             label = "X:";
             key = "B_SCREW_COLUMN_CENTER_X_DCL";
             edit_width = 18;
             mnemonic = "X";
             }
           :edit_box
             {
             label = "Y:";
             key = "B_SCREW_COLUMN_CENTER_Y_DCL";
             edit_width = 18;
             mnemonic = "Y";
             }
           :edit_box
             {
             label = "Z:";
             key = "B_SCREW_COLUMN_CENTER_Z_DCL";
             edit_width = 18;
             mnemonic = "Z";
             }
           }
         }
       :column
         {
         :boxed_column
           {
           label = "尺寸选择";
           :column
             {
             children_alignment=centered;
             :row
               {
               :text_part
                 {
                 label = "当前螺纹&U:";     //  style name
                 width =10;
                 fixed_width = true;
                 }
               :edit_box
                 {                        // for user to enter/specify
               key = "B_SCREW_COLUMN_DIAMETER_DCL";
                 edit_width = 11;
                 edit_limit = 10;
                 }
               }
             :popup_list
               {
               label = "螺纹选择&S:";
               key = "B_SCREW_COLUMN_DIAMETER_S_DCL";
               list = "1.6\n2.0\n2.5\n3.0\n4.0\n5.0\n6.0\n8.0\n10.0\n12.0\n16.0\n20.0\n24.0\n30.0\n36.0";
               edit_width = 10;
               }  
             }
           :row
             {
             :text_part
               {
               label = "当前长度&L:";     //  style name
               width =10;
               fixed_width = true;
               }
             :edit_box
               {                        // for user to enter/specify
             key = "B_SCREW_COLUMN_LENGTH_DCL";
             edit_width = 11;
             edit_limit = 10;
               }
             }
           :popup_list
             {
             label = "长度系列&G:";
             key = "B_SCREW_COLUMN_LENGTH_S_DCL";
             edit_width = 10;
             }  
           errtile;
           }
         :row
           {
           :toggle
             {
             label = "弹簧垫圈&S";
             key = "B_SCREW_COLUMN_WASHER_SPRING_DCL";
             mnemonic = "S";
             alignment =centered;
             }   
           :toggle
             {
             label = "平 垫 圈&F";
             key = "B_SCREW_COLUMN_WASHER_FLAT_DCL";
             mnemonic = "F";
             alignment =centered;
             }   
           }   
         :boxed_column
           {
           label = "插入角度";
           :button
             {
             label = "角度选择&N:";
             key = "B_SCREW_COLUMN_ANGLE_S_DCL";
             edit_width = 10;
             alignment = centered;
             }
           :edit_box
             {
             label = "角度&A:";
             key = "B_SCREW_COLUMN_ANGLE_DCL";
             edit_width = 14;
             mnemonic = "N";
             }
           }
         }
       }
     }
   :boxed_column
     {
     label = "国家标准号";
     key = "B_GB";
      :column
        {
        children_alignment=centered;
        :row
          {
          :text_part
            {
            label = " 当 前 标 准 号&C:";
            width =10;
            fixed_width = true;
            }
          :edit_box
            {                        
          key = "B_SCREW_COLUMN_CRITERION_DCL";
            edit_width = 32;
            edit_limit = 100;
            }
          }
        :popup_list
          {
          label = "选 择 标 准 号 &B:";
          key = "B_SCREW_COLUMN_CRITERION_S_DCL";
          list = "内六角圆柱头螺钉(GB/T70-1985)";
          edit_width = 31.2;
          }  
        }
     }

   : row
      {
      alignment=centered;
      ok_cancel;
      }
   : boxed_column
      {
      label = " ";
       : text
          {
          label="  >>版权所有,翻录不究<<";
          alignment=centered;
          }
       : text
          {
          label="     >>作者:B。W<<";
          alignment=centered;
          }
      }
   }
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|申请友链|Archiver|手机版|小黑屋|辽公网安备|晓东CAD家园 ( 辽ICP备15016793号 )

GMT+8, 2024-11-16 17:39 , Processed in 0.233101 second(s), 32 queries , Gzip On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表